The opening was made, while researchers from the archaeological monument and the University of Valencia worked on excavations focused on the necropolis port -ar, which was near the city, As reported in the news release. The site served buried and was discovered in the 1990s during the railway construction. Since 1998, the researchers have found evidence of more than 50 cremation burials in Necolis. The current excavations, called the “Investigation of Death Archeology in Pompei”, have been ongoing since July 2024.

The statues were found in the southern half of the grave covered with pumice, stone, According to a report by researchers. The pumice stone showed that this part of the tomb was buried in the earthquakes shortly before the eruption of the Mountain Vesuvia.
The figures are funeral relief, the researchers said. According to the researchers, the couple may have married and it seems that it was “good”.
“The delicacy and the sculpture detail are great,” the researchers write. “We can appreciate the thorough thread of hands, fingers and nails. We can also see a detailed work on the folds of clothing and decorations: rings, bracelets, necklaces, etc.”
The woman's figure includes carved accessories that may indicate that she was a priestess of Ceres, Roman harvest and fertility goddess. Researchers said it was probably only women from famous families held this position. The priests had political power and had the highest social status for Roman women. The statues of the priestesses that occupy the subjects related to their positions in the south of Italy are very rare, the researchers said.

The man wears a hug who shows that he is a Roman citizen. Both are depicted wearing rings that can be wedding groups.
Other relics were found, including the ointment banks that may have had a fragrant oil, a broken mirror and a coin depicting the Nptune Maritime God. Researchers may have been important in funeral rites.
The statues may apply to the late republican period, which ranged from 133 to 31 BC, the researchers said.
The statues were transferred to another part of Pompeii for restoration work. They will be presented at an exhibition that focused on women's age in ancient Pompeii, which will open on April 16. The restoration will be carried out before visitors of the exhibition, the park said.
